How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Skyline East?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Skyline East 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,374 | $2,100 | $9,609 |
Skyline East 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,812 | $2,352 | $8,815 |

How much rent can you afford?
The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.

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Skyline East Apartments
What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Skyline East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Skyline East is a 1,018 square feet unit starting from $2,352 at Meadowbrook.
What is the average size for Skyline East 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Skyline East is currently 1,537 sq ft.
